The Undeniable Benefits of Regular HVAC Maintenance
- Improved Energy Efficiency & Lower Bills: Over time, dust, debris, and normal wear can reduce your HVAC system's efficiency. A professional tune-up involves cleaning and calibration that helps your unit operate at peak performance, consuming less energy to achieve desired temperatures. This directly translates to noticeable savings on your monthly energy bills.
- Extended System Lifespan: An HVAC system is a significant investment. Regular maintenance helps identify and address minor issues before they escalate into major problems, reducing strain on components and extending the overall life of your furnace and air conditioner. This preventative approach saves you the cost of premature replacement.
- Enhanced Indoor Comfort & Air Quality: A well-maintained system provides more consistent heating and cooling throughout your home, eliminating hot or cold spots. Furthermore, checking and replacing air filters and inspecting ductwork can significantly improve your home's indoor air quality by reducing allergens, dust, and pollutants.
- Prevent Costly Breakdowns & Emergency Repairs: The most inconvenient and expensive time for an HVAC system to fail is often when it's working the hardest during peak seasons. Tune-ups help identify potential issues, such as worn parts or low refrigerant levels, before they cause a complete system breakdown, saving you from urgent, expensive repairs.
- Maintaining Manufacturer Warranties: Many HVAC manufacturers require proof of annual professional maintenance to keep your system's warranty valid. Skipping tune-ups could void your warranty, leaving you responsible for the full cost of repairs if a major component fails.
- Ensuring Home Safety: For heating systems, especially gas furnaces, a tune-up includes critical safety checks. Technicians inspect for gas leaks, check the heat exchanger for cracks (which can lead to carbon monoxide leaks), and ensure all safety controls are functioning correctly, protecting your household.
When to Schedule Your HVAC Tune-Up: A Seasonal Guide
To ensure optimal performance year-round, we recommend scheduling two professional tune-ups annually:
- Spring for Your Air Conditioning: Before the summer heat descends on Centennial, a spring tune-up prepares your cooling system for heavy use. This ensures it's ready to handle the increased demand, operates efficiently, and keeps your home cool without unexpected issues.
- Fall for Your Heating System: As temperatures drop and winter approaches, a fall tune-up is crucial for your heating system. This prepares your furnace or heat pump for the colder months, ensuring reliable warmth and confirming safe operation before you depend on it daily.
Beyond these seasonal recommendations, consider scheduling a tune-up if you notice any signs of trouble, such as unusual noises, weak airflow, rising energy bills without increased usage, or your system frequently cycling on and off.

Cooling System Tune-Up Checklist
When we perform an AC tune-up for your Centennial home, our expert technicians carry out a detailed inspection and adjustment process, which typically includes:
- Inspect and Clean Condenser Coils
- Check Refrigerant Levels & Inspect for Leaks
- Inspect and Clear Condensate Drain
- Check Electrical Connections and Tighten
- Lubricate Moving Parts
- Inspect Blower Components
- Test Thermostat Calibration
- Check Temperature Split
- Inspect Air Filter
- Verify Proper System Operation
Heating System Tune-Up Checklist
For your furnace or heat pump, our thorough heating tune-up includes:
- Inspect and Clean Burners and Ignition Assembly
- Check Heat Exchanger for Cracks/Corrosion
- Measure Gas Pressure & Adjust as Needed
- Test Safety Controls & Limit Switches
- Inspect Flue Piping for Obstructions
- Lubricate Moving Parts
- Test Thermostat Calibration
- Check Airflow & Fan Control
- Inspect Air Filter
- Perform Carbon Monoxide Test
- Verify Proper System Operation

How often should I get my HVAC system tuned up? For optimal performance, efficiency, and longevity, we recommend having your HVAC system tuned up twice a year: once in the spring for your air conditioning unit and once in the fall for your heating system. This prepares your system for the peak demands of summer and winter.

How long does an HVAC tune-up take? Typically, a comprehensive HVAC tune-up takes about 1 to 2 hours, depending on the complexity of your system and any immediate issues that require attention. Our technicians work efficiently while ensuring thoroughness.
Can a tune-up prevent major HVAC repairs? Yes, absolutely. One of the significant advantages of regular HVAC tune-ups is their preventative nature. By identifying and addressing small issues like worn components, low refrigerant, or dirty coils early on, a tune-up can often prevent these minor problems from escalating into major, expensive repairs or complete system failures.
